Game Basics and Theme
Chicken Road 2 is a crash‑style arcade title created by InOut Games and launched in 2024. Set against a cartoon chicken adventure backdrop, the game keeps the visuals playful while the core mechanic stays razor‑sharp.
The core premise is simple: place a bet, watch the multiplier climb as the chicken gallops across a treacherous road, and decide when to bail before the inevitable crash.
The game offers a maximum payout of up to ten thousand times your stake, giving even the smallest wager the potential for big results.
How the Crash Mechanic Works in Minutes
The round starts at 1.00x and increases almost linearly as the chicken moves forward. Each tick in time can see the multiplier rise by a fraction of a cent—enough to keep you guessing.
The moment the chicken stumbles—whether it’s a pothole or a sudden splash—your round ends instantly, and if you haven’t cashed out yet, your stake is lost.
Because each crash is random, there’s an element of luck interwoven with skill: you must gauge how long you’re willing to ride that rising curve.
